Industry Advisory Board

IABs are innovative forums that can create new mechanisms to help students have a deeper interaction with industry.

Industry Advisory Boards (IABs) ensure that industry is an equal partner in the university’s academic endeavours. The IABs advise the NU leadership on industry trends and directions. By involving industry in relevant processes and functions of the university, NU puts its core principle of providing an education aligned with industry trends and needs into action.

There are IABs for each academic programme, and its members participate in the entire spectrum of activities from admissions to placements. By participating in academic functions and working with faculty on research projects, IABs help in narrowing the gulf that exists between academia and industry.

IAB support for NU includes:

  • Programme design
  • Curriculum design and content
  • Identifying adjunct faculty from industry
  • Selection process for high-calibre students
  • Identifying research projects
  • Processes and facilitation for Industrial Practice and other internships
  • Placements
  • Establishing innovation centres

Research Advisory Board

The RAB helps strengthen NU’s research orientation, so it evolves into a leading hub of innovation.
NU’s Research Advisory Board (RAB) comprises renowned academic and industry researchers from across the world. These leading researchers bring to NU their deep knowledge, research and academic rigour in the technologies of the future such as robotics, cloud computing, mobile networking, high-performance computing, Internet of Things, and cyber security, etc.
The aim of the RAB is to help drive the university’s core principle of research-driven education. It advises and actively engages with NU on all research-related matters. It also enables the university to forge linkages and partnerships with reputed international schools of higher learning, as well as with leading research and development (R&D) labs in India and abroad.
RAB facilitates a two-way interaction between the labs and NU by encouraging leading researchers from these labs to accept visiting and adjunct faculty positions at NU. In turn, it also helps PhD students from the university to connect with researchers. At a broader level, the RAB helps NU outline its research agenda and priorities.
